Netflix’s latest South Korean series, Trigger , comes from writer/director Kwon Oh-seung ( Midnight ) and stars Kim Nam-gil and Kim Young-kwang. The premise is deceptively simple: What happens when guns are introduced into a country that has essentially been gun-free? Where annual gun deaths can be counted on one hand?

The series plays out like a grim social experiment. Someone is anonymously shipping firearms - packaged like Amazon deliveries - to everyday South Koreans who are bullied, marginalized, unseen, or simply fed up.
